The Cathedral of Barcelona - El Catedral de Barcelona
The morning sun glows behind the spires as people wait for the Cathedral to open for the day. Construction of the gothic Cathedral of Barcelona began in 1298 and took 150 years to complete. The main façade is several hundred years younger. It was constructed between the years 1887-1913. You have to pay to enter the Cathedral which is well worth the minimum €9.00 that gets you full access to everything but the museum. Construction on the Choir of the Cathedral was begun in 1390. Statue of San Jordi in the Cathedral of Barcelona If you know what you are looking for, you will find evidence of San Jordi, San Jorge, or Saint George (to list just a few of the translations of his name) all over Europe. He is the patron saint of Catalonia, Aragon, England, Germany, Portugal, Greece, Georgia,...
